Cowpots

Cowpots would be a fun item to give and would probably be a good conversation starter. These pots are made from composted cow manure and are great for starting seeds. The entire pot can then be planted in the ground and will provide a source of fertilizer for newly planted transplants.

Soaker Hose

With weather patterns changing and our summers getting hotter with less rain, this SoakerPRO soaker hose would make a good gift for the gardener that does not have an automated sprinkler system. Weave this soaker hose throughout a flower or vegetable bed, cover with soil or compost and your water will go directly to the roots without evaporating.

AdLok Chainlock Ties

One of my favorite gifts, that I bought myself, is this AgLok tying device. Most gardeners, at some time during the season, have to tie-up plants. You can forget about string and twine with this system and the ties last all year and can easily be adjusted to increase or decrease, depending on what is needed. It is the best tying system that I have found.

Soil Test Kit

Of all the gifts mentioned, if I had to pick just one, it would be this Soil Test Kit. Before planting anything, it is important to know something about your soil and what it needs. Having a soil test is often neglected and it should be one of the most important tasks. Many future problems with plants can be greatly diminished by adding the nutrients that a soil lacks. This is a quick and easy way to find out what is in your soil. Follow directions and scoop up some soil and send it off in the prepaid postage envelope. Your results will come back with an analysis of your specific soil. The results may surprise you, it certainly did me.
